Teddy Thompson releases A Piece today, tours into fall

The singer/songwriter title is one often associated with coffee shops, acoustic guitars and '60s-era NYC. In short, folk music. But many artists have expanded the persona to include more handclaps than harmonicas and soaring vocals rather than sullen ones, giving the genre a sound that is decidedly more pop and (sometimes) less protest.

One such artist is Teddy Thompson. The son of folk legends Richard and Linda Thompson, Teddy is releases his fourth studio album, A Piece of What You Need, today, amidst a UK/US tour that extends well into the fall.


Thompson's senior album is produced by Marius DeVries, whose collaboration list includes several artists of the same modern-folk aesthetic, such as Rufus Wainwright and David Gray.


After a brief foray into covering country on this third album, Up Front and Down Low, Thompson returns to the sounds of his sophomore effort, Separate Ways, on A Piece of What You Need.
